mysql基础知识笔记(MySQL学习实践DAY18-表的创建和操作)

WHAT:数据库的结构是-库-表-列行,所以表是记录数据(信息)的地方,表是二维结构数据记录,其中的列是用来归类和格式化数据的,行是用来定位数据的,接下来我们就来聊聊关于mysql基础知识笔记?以下内容大家不妨参考一二希望能帮到您!

mysql基础知识笔记(MySQL学习实践DAY18-表的创建和操作)

mysql基础知识笔记

WHAT:

数据库的结构是-库-表-列行,所以表是记录数据(信息)的地方,表是二维结构数据记录,其中的列是用来归类和格式化数据的,行是用来定位数据的。


WHY:

表是用来记录信息的,所以没有表的数据库没有任何作用。


HOW

1-表的创建

CREATE TABLE [表的名字]

(

[列的名字] [数据类型] [列值的属性]

[列的名字] [数据类型] [列值的属性]

PRIMARY KEY([列名])

)ENGINE=InnoDB;

说明:创建表需要定义如下项目:

1)表的名字

2)列的名字

3)列的数据类型

4)列值属性,是否允许空值,是否有默认值或是否自动增量。

5)设置主健和外键

6)确定引擎


2-表的操作-增加列

ALTER TABLE [表的名字] ADD [列的名字] [数据类型] [列值的属性];


3-表的操作-删除列

ALTER TABLE [表的名字] DROP [列的名字] [数据类型] [列值的属性];


4-表的重命名

RENAME TABLE [表的名字] TO [表的名字]


5-表的删除

DROP TABLE [表的名字];


,

免责声明:本文仅代表文章作者的个人观点,与本站无关。其原创性、真实性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容文字的真实性、完整性和原创性本站不作任何保证或承诺,请读者仅作参考,并自行核实相关内容。文章投诉邮箱:anhduc.ph@yahoo.com

    分享
    投诉
    首页